Everyone in… it’s time for a beach break on the edge of Exmoor National Park. From Watermouth Valley Camping Park, a five-minute walk will get you to Watermouth Bay, where there’s fabulous rock fishing and spectacular coastal walks. That’s not all, believe it or not. The Victorian town of Ilfracombe is 10 minutes’ drive away and surfing beaches such as Woolacombe beach (25 minutes’ drive) and Croyde beach (35 minutes) are also within driving distance. Further on, characterful Lynton and Lynmouth (half an hour) can be found too. Of course, the site is right on the South West Coast Path around North Devon, so it’s a very wise base for hiking fans (just pick up a map of the local area from the site’s shop). What about Watermouth Valley Camping Park itself? Well, the family-run, dog-friendly site has sea views and a sheltered valley where guests can relax and take in the scenery. There’s a children’s adventure playground for kids to let off steam, a handy on-site shop and a modern, clean amenities block with hot showers and electric points for hair dryers, straighteners and razors. The site gets very popular with families during the school summer holidays (May through to September), but at other times, it’s quiet and peaceful and attracts couples and solo travellers.

Local attractions

Time to tick off the North Devon coves and harbours? Start with splendid Combe Martin (five minutes’ drive), a seaside resort with a sheltered cove for peaceful days on the sand. Surfers might want to slide on over to Saunton Sands (half an hour), while those seeking scenic clifftop hikes will get on well with the Valley of Rocks’ (35 minutes) wild goats and sea views. Take off on a fishing trip or a sea safari from Ilfracombe Harbour (10 minutes). Lundy Island is one of the most popular tour spots for such boat trips. There’s a working lifeboat station in the harbour too if that sort of stuff entertains you. Once you’ve checked out the lifeboats, turn back time a little with a trip to Arlington Court (20 minutes), a National Trust site with a Regency house and a carriage museum. Or perhaps all the way back to the time of dinosaurs? Kids are likely to love the life-sized dino models at Combe Martin Wildlife & Dinosaur Park (10 minutes) and its zoo and fossil museum.
